Term
Definition
commandable property   A property that may be written with a priority on a scale from 1 (most important) to 16 (least important)  
🗑
static device binding   The manual association of network numbers and MAC addresses with BACnet Device instances.  
🗑
dynamic object binding   The identification of nodes containing certain objects with the Who-Has and I-Have services.  
🗑
dynamic device binding   The automatic discovery of network numbers and MAC address bindings for corresponding BACnet Device instances.  
🗑
algorithmic change reporting   A BACnet alarming feature that uses Event Enrollment objects to configure the alarm/event behavior of some other object property.  
🗑
intrinsic reporting   An alarming feature of certain BACnet objects where the alarm or event originates from the object.  
🗑
ramping   The changing from one lighting level to another at a fixed rate of change of level per second.  
🗑
clamping   The restriction of lighting level between minimum and maximum levels, as long as the light is ON.  
🗑
fading   The changing from one lighting level to another over a fixed period.  
🗑
terminal   A human-machine interface (HMI) that serves as an input and display device for text-based communication with another computer-based device.  
🗑
stepping   The incremental increasing or decreasing of lighting level in fixed steps.  
🗑
XML   A general-purpose specification for annotating text with information on structure and organization.  
🗑
open building information exchange (oBIX)   An XML-based model for conveying control information between any building automation protocols, including enterprise and proprietary protocols.  
🗑
BACnet XML   A proposed XML-based model for conveying control information between BACnet and other protocols.  
🗑
intermediary framework   A complete software and/or hardware solution for integrating multiple network-based protocol systems through a centralized interface.  
🗑
gateway   A network device that translates transmitted information between different protocols.  
🗑
mapping   The process of making an association between comparable concepts in a gateway.  
🗑
enterprise system   A software and networking solution for managing business operations.  
🗑
Extensible Markup Language (XML)   A general-purpose specification for annotating text with information on structure and organization.  
🗑
energy harvesting   A strategy where a device obtains power from its surrounding environment.  
🗑
data warehouse   A dedicated storage area for electronic data.
